Redefining Family One Letter at a Time
A Cinematic Shift in Toy Marketing
Directed by Nico Pérez Veiga of Primo, the film departed from the clinical, high - energy aesthetic typical of toy commercials. Instead, it utilized a warm, "indie film" visual palette captured by DoP Alexander Melman. The narrative relied almost entirely on silent visual storytelling and a poignant score by Siren, allowing the emotional weight of the daughter’s transition to transcend language barriers. This "silent narrative" approach was a deliberate choice by LOLA MullenLowe to ensure the message felt like a quiet family reality rather than a loud political statement.
The Power of Meaningful Anagrams
The campaign served as a spiritual successor to the agency’s previous "Anagram Lovers" work, further cementing Scrabble’s brand identity around the emotional weight of words. Executive Creative Director Pancho Cassis noted that while Scrabble is a game of words, the campaign was truly about the "meanings we give them." By using the physical wooden tiles as a narrative device to track the protagonist's journey, the product became the literal connective tissue of the story.

Global Resonance and Social Reach
Though originally launched for Mattel España during the 2017 Christmas season, the film achieved immediate global virality. It amassed millions of views within weeks and was heavily amplified by LGBTQ+ advocacy groups. This organic reach successfully repositioned Scrabble for Gen Z and Millennial demographics, moving the brand away from "nuclear family" tropes and toward a more socially conscious identity. The tagline, "Your words, your meanings," (Tus palabras, tus significados) became a central pillar for the brand’s modern relevance.
Creative Strategy Deconstructed
Company
Scrabble, as a word game, could credibly deliver a message about the power and meaning of words to define human connections.
Category
The board game category often depicted idealized, traditional family settings, limiting its appeal to a narrow demographic.
Customer
Audiences desired to see their own diverse family structures and relationships reflected and validated in mainstream media.
Culture
A growing cultural movement embraced inclusivity and challenged traditional definitions of family, making the timing ripe for this message.
